How to Create a Group on WhatsApp: A Step-by-Step Guide

Creating a WhatsApp group is a straightforward process that enhances communication by allowing multiple participants to engage in real-time conversations. Here’s how you can set up your group quickly and easily:

  1. Open WhatsApp: Launch the app on your smartphone. Ensure you have the latest version for a smooth experience.

  2. Navigate to Chats: Tap on the 'Chats' tab located at the bottom of the screen. This will display your current conversations.

  3. Start a New Group: Click on the 'New Group' option at the top-right corner. On some versions, you might find it by tapping the menu button (three dots).

  4. Select Participants: You can add participants by selecting their contacts. Simply tap on the names of individuals you wish to include in the group, and click 'Next'.

  5. Set Group Name and Photo: Choose a catchy name for your group to identify its purpose or theme. You can also add a group photo by tapping the camera icon.

  6. Create Group: Once you’ve set up the necessary details, tap 'Create' to finalize your group.

To manage your group, you can access the group settings to edit details, add new participants, or even promote additional administrators. Group controls are crucial for handling larger groups, ensuring that only administrators can send messages if desired.
